1построить линейные алгоритмы для решения следующих : а) вычислить площадь и периметр треугольника по данным трем сторонампериметр треугольника: p = a + b + cплощадь треугольника: s = √((p(p-a)(p-b)(p- где p = p/2б) вычислить площадь и периметр прямоугольника по данным ширине и высотепериметр прямоугольника: p = 2(a + b)площадь прямоугольника: s = abв) вычислить площадь и периметр круга по заданному радиусупериметр круга: p = 2πrплощадь круга: s = πr22 построить разветвляющий алгоритм для решения следующей : найти корни квадратного уравнения и вывести их на экран, если они есть. если корней нет, то вывести сообщение об этом. конкретное квадратное уравнение определяется коэффициентами a, b, c, которые вводит пользователь.квадратное уравнение имеет вид ax2 + bx + c = 0. коэффициенты a, b и c - это конкретные числа, а x надо найти, решив уравнение. примерный текстовый алгоритм решения: вычислить дискриминант по формуле d = b2 - 4ac. если дискриминант больше нуля, то вычислить два корня уравнения: x1 = (-b+√d) / 2ax2 = (-b-√d) / 2a если дискриминант равен нулю, то вычислить только один корень (второй будет равен ему).если дискриминант отрицателен, то вывести сообщение, что корней нетинформатика